When defective machinery causes injury or death at a construction site or in an industrial setting, it is important to determine the cause of the accident. Not only does the injured person or the bereaved family need compensation, but also future users of such equipment need to be protected. Preventive action after an accidental injury demands a complete investigation into the causes of the accident and an implementation of repairs or revised safety procedures.
If you are the one who was injured or who lost a family member in an accident caused by defective machinery, you may not be worried at this time about future users of the machinery. Your focus is naturally on your own injury or loss and resulting family crisis. You need practical, legal and financial help to cope with the effects of a serious accident. You need help to cover expenses and deal with losses including the following:
- Medical bills
- Lost wage replacement
- Pain and suffering
- Funeral and burial costs if applicable
